Moonee Valley (VIC) - Saturday 2 March 2002
Track: GOOD
Weather: OVERCAST
Rail: TRUE POSITION

Riding Changes: Nil

Race 1 - CARLTON DRAUGHT HANDICAP - 1200 metres

On jumping away, Violet Tints and Lorette bumped, mainly due to Lorette jumping away awkwardly and then shifting out.

Approaching the 800 metres, Froth and Bubble shifted in abruptly towards Eulalie, which had also shifted in, and as a result was inconvenienced.

Race 2 - STRATHAYR HANDICAP - 1600 metres

Circumnavigating jumped away awkwardly.

D Gauci, rider of Circumnavigating, explained to the Stewards that his mount had travelled extremely well in the early and middle stages of the race, but when asked to go forward approaching the 700 metres, Circumnavigating failed to respond to his riding. He added that Circumnavigating and Love A Laga bumped near the 700 metres due to his mount shifting out, but in his view this had no bearing on Circumnavigating's performance. D Gauci further added that Circumnavigating appeared to pull up well. A veterinary examination of Circumnavigating revealed no apparent abnormality.

Race 3 - GUINNESS - HAVE YOU SEEN THE DARK HANDICAP - 3000 metres

Covet Cross was slow to begin.

On two occasions over the concluding stages of the race, Our Only Vice (NZ) shifted in and inconvenienced Mt Stromlo (NZ).

Race 4 - THE WATERFORD CRYSTAL - 1600 metres

On jumping away, Blue Marwina was hampered due to Tickle My shifting out.

Near the 200 metres, Tickle My had to be checked off the heels of Runs on Ego.

D Oliver, rider of Panoramic Lad, explained to the Stewards that he had elected not to put his mount under full pressure near the 600 metres on the inside of Runs On Ego as he was concerned that he may then be in a pocket between Runs On Ego and Marlie (NZ). He stated that he also wished to see whether Risky Venture, which was racing on the outside of Runs On Ego, weakened quickly at that point, which would have left him with an option to shift to the outside of Runs On Ego.

Acting on confirmed advice from Mr D J Hall that Saboteur was lame in the near foreleg and unable to run, the Stewards withdrew the gelding from the race at 3.30 pm. Mr Hall will produce a veterinary certificate in respect of Saboteur.

Race 5 - THE QUIET MAN IRISH PUB HANDICAP - 1000 metres

On jumping away, Sir Talaq was tightened on to Show No Emotion by Straight Ace, which jumped away awkwardly and shifted out.

Near the 200 metres, Gold Boom, which had been racing tight on the outside of Show No Emotion, was inconvenienced due to Dalla Vista shifting in. In the incident, L Milham, rider of Gold Boom, became unbalanced.

Rounding the home turn near the 500 metres, Straight Ace shifted out slightly away from the running rail and bumped Ol' Blue Eyes.

Race 6 - MV GREAT RACE SWEEPSTAKE HANDICAP - 1200 metres

On jumping away, Provident had to be checked when tightened for room between Indigo Rain and Spine Tingler, both of which shifted ground. Shortly after being checked, Provident knuckled.

Near the 1,000 metres, Tyra was tightened for room by Chalonnaise (NZ) which shifted in away from Duchess Kachia, which shifted in at that stage. Whilst the Stewards accepted there were some circumstances, they notified N Callow to ensure that he leaves comfortable room for runners on his inside in future.

Near the 800 metres, Tyra brushed the rail when racing tight on the inside of Duchess Kachia.

On straightening, Gateway Bid was inconvenienced due to Rich Ruby Red shifting in.

After passing the 100 metres, Spine Tingler had to be checked when attempting a narrow run between Saxophone and Indigo Rain, which shifted in slightly.

Race 7 - CLUB COZMO HANDICAP - 2040 metres

Kinjika began awkwardly, shifted out, and bumped Loire Valley.

Near the 400 metres, She's Hand Picked (NZ), which was weakening, was bumped by Our Riesling (NZ), which shifted out when improving its position.

SWAB SAMPLES - routine swab samples were taken from the winners of all races tonight.

ADJOURNED INQUIRY - Melbourne Racing Club, Autumn Country Cup, adjourned inquiry, 23/2/02. Mr P. A. Healey, trainer of Mr Bombastic, was fined the sum of $50 for nominating that horse when ineligible.
